Charlie spent the entire morning rehearsing what he was going to say to Enkai.

The mirror had heard at least five different versions already.

"Enkai," Charlie said seriously to his reflection, standing way too straight, "I'm not gay, and I don't think this will work… but we can still be friends."

He even added a dramatic hand gesture for emphasis.

Then he immediately gasped and clutched his chest.

"No! I hate you, Charlie!" he shouted at himself, switching roles instantly. "I can't believe you'd do this after everything I've done for you! You heartless beast!"

Charlie paused, staring at his own reflection.

"…Okay, yeah. He would never react like that."

Enkai was calm. Collected. Annoyingly handsome. If anything, he'd probably just smile politely and move on with his perfect life.

Ugh.

"Who am I kidding?" Charlie muttered, rubbing his face. "He's ridiculously attractive. He probably doesn't even care. I'm the only one who'd lose here."

He groaned. "What if he's not even into me? What if I just embarrass myself?"

Charlie sighed deeply.

"He's definitely into girls," he concluded, nodding like he'd solved a mystery.

Right on cue, his phone buzzed.

Enkai: I'm here.

Charlie's heart dropped straight to his stomach.

"Hey, pretty boy."

Charlie froze.

Enkai stood by the open car door, one hand resting casually on the roof, sunlight hitting him like he belonged on a magazine cover. He smiled easily, like this wasn't doing irreversible damage to Charlie's sanity.

Why was he so effortlessly handsome?

Why was life so unfair?

And why was he polite on top of that?

Handsome bastard.

"Why are you looking at me like that?" Charlie blurted out, suddenly self-conscious.

Enkai's gaze had lingered...slow, curious, unashamed...running over him in a way that made Charlie want to evaporate.

"You're showing a lot of skin," Enkai said lightly.

Charlie's brain short-circuited.

He was wearing loose brown shorts that hit just above his knees and a fitted sleeveless gray shirt that clung softly to his frame. The fabric was thin, catching the breeze, and his curls looked brighter than usual under the sun"warm, untamed, glowing. His pale skin almost shimmered, freckles faint but visible if you looked closely.

Comfortable. Casual.

Apparently… distracting.

"I... I'm hot," Charlie stammered, fanning himself awkwardly. "It's really hot today, you know."

His cheeks burned as he hurried into the car, avoiding Enkai's gaze like it might physically harm him.

Enkai chuckled quietly before getting in and starting the engine.

They were just about to drive off when Charlie suddenly reached out and grabbed Enkai's sleeve.

"Um… maybe we should talk."

Enkai stopped immediately.

"Okay," he said, turning toward Charlie without hesitation...leaning in a little too close.

Way too close.

Charlie's mouth opened.

Nothing came out.

Enkai's face was right there--calm eyes, soft expression, patiently waiting. Charlie could hear his own heartbeat louder than the car engine.

"I..." Charlie swallowed. "Umm…"

The words were stuck somewhere between his brain and his mouth, refusing to cooperate.

Enkai tilted his head slightly. "Take your time."

And just like that, Charlie's carefully rehearsed speech completely fell apart.

"Do you like guys?"

Wow.

Bravo, Charlie.

Ten minutes of silence and that was the best you could do?

Charlie immediately wanted the car to swallow him whole.

Enkai definitely hates me now, he thought, shame piling up neatly like folded laundry on his chest.

"Well," Enkai said casually, like he'd been asked what he wanted for lunch, "I go both ways. But I guess you could say I prefer guys."

Charlie blinked.

"…What a waste of good looks," he muttered before his brain could stop his mouth.

"What?" Enkai asked, eyebrows lifting.

"Nothing!" Charlie said way too loudly, forcing an awkward laugh that echoed painfully in the car. "Haha. Nothing at all."

Silence followed.

Charlie panicked.

Say something. Apologize. Explain. Do literally anything.

Why is he so quiet?

Of course he's quiet...you asked a weird question, idiot.

"I should probably..."

"Do you like me?"

The question hit him like a brick.

"Yes!" Charlie blurted out immediately. "I mean... I'm really sorry...wait, what?"

"You're sorry for liking me?" Enkai asked, amused. "I mean, I'm not surprised. I do have an irresistible charm."

Charlie froze.

…Huh?

Excuse him? What was this man on?

"Oh no, absolutely not," Charlie snapped, his embarrassment instantly mutating into rage. "First of all, who has been feeding your ego? That is a very shitty thing to say, you asshole!"

Enkai didn't even flinch.

"Should I work on my ego?" he asked calmly. "I could. Especially since I like you too. But you'd have to ask nicely."

Charlie's brain blue-screened.

"Wait... no...that's not how it's supposed to be"

Enkai's phone suddenly rang.

He glanced at the screen and sighed. "It's my secretary. This must be important. I'll be right back."

And just like that, he stepped out of the car, leaving Charlie alone with his thoughts--and his rapidly unraveling sanity.

"What the hell just happened?!" Charlie whispered, grabbing his hair.

"No... why did I focus on his ego instead of fixing the misunderstanding?" he groaned. "What is wrong with me?"

He slumped back into the seat.

"I've always been bad at communicating, but wow. This takes the cake."

I need to fix this, he decided, determination rising.

But then Enkai's voice replayed in his head, smooth and teasing.

I'll fix it if you ask nicely.

Because I like you too.

Charlie's legs went weak.

"…He likes me," Charlie whispered.

Suddenly, a sharp slap echoed in the car.

"Ow!" Charlie hissed, his right hand stinging.

"Get it together," he scolded himself. "He's just being nice. There is absolutely no way you believe all that."

Absolutely.

No way.

(He absolutely believed all of it.)
